trying to install a remote start in 04 jetta with factory locks and alarm. I am using a Omega RS-3A start unit and i purchased a Omega IM 510 door lock and bypass  module. I need some help with the wiring. I have the remote start wired in with the exception of  the pink wire which says goes to alarm or keyless entry. I am not sure where that  wire goes. Also the instructions for the IM 510 suck and am not clear on how to hook  that in at all. I was told you have to put the key in the box although it doesnt say that. The instruction sheet for that says platform #01 VWDL (door lock control).  The door control module on this car is in the drivers door.Will i have to tap in there?  Any help would be appreciated.  thanks  Mike

If it's a Mk IV, use a 556UW from directed, will need key, discard it's antenna and use the scheme for European cars,wire alarm directly to to lock/unlock wires in door, externd time on lock wire for total (comfort) close, the only way to shut down factory alarm is to KILL it, find contol box under dash, cut indicator wires (BLACK/ white and BLACK/ green) cut siren wire, (BLACK / YELLOW I think,) cut ultrasonic wire (coax with 2 inners and a grounding sleeve). Recognising the key, the remote start will therefore not trigger the alarm.
